Quezon’s Bagsakan Center and SLSU-Lucena receive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) Training from DOST-Quezon

The Sentrong Pamilihan ng Produktong Agrikultura sa Quezon Foundation, Inc. (SPPAQFI) and the Southern Luzon State University (SLSU) Lucena Campus received current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MP) Training from the Department of Science and Technology-Quezon (DOST-Quezon) from April 17 to 18, 2023 at SLSU-Lucena Campus, Ibabang Dupay, Lucena City, Quezon.

The DOST-Quezon through its resident Food Safety members, Ms. Precious Monedera and Ms. Amiel Lacdan, facilitated the training for SPPAQFI production staff and SLSU faculty members.

This training was aimed to capacitate its participants to properly handle food and food materials in processing to avoid contamination whilst maintaining top quality products.

SPPAQFI, a non-stock, non-profit organization located at Maharlika Highway, Sariaya, Quezon, is the identified beneficiary for the DOST project “Leveling-Up of Quezon’s Bagsakan Agri-Processing Capability Through Adoption of the Smart Food Value Chain Framework” of DOST CALABARZON in partnership with SLSU.#
